Luminaries from Hollywood and politics reacted on Friday to the death of Sidney Poitier, who broke through racial barriers and inspired a generation during the civil rights movement.

Actor Sidney Poitier who has died at the age of 94, epitomised dignity and grace, revealing the power of movies to bring us closer together, former president Barack Obama said.Luminaries from Hollywood and politics reacted on Friday to the death of Sidney Poitier, who broke through racial barriers as the first Black actor to win an Oscar for his leading role in “Lilies of the Field,” and inspired a generation during the civil rights movement.
